Handover — Priya to Oskar, for the eng sync. This week I moved Beaconette's telemetry payloads from raw JSON to delta-encoded batches with dictionary compression, cutting median payload size by roughly 70%. The decoder is backward compatible; old agents still send uncompressed and are handled fine. Remaining work: the flush interval needs tuning for low-traffic devices, and the compression dictionary should rotate weekly. Benchmarks, the rollout plan, and open questions are written up on the page below.

operations page: https://jenkins.zemvarcloud.local/job/merge_requests/repo/build/73930b4b30f0a8ed

Handover — Reportly timezone fix

For review: Reportly exports were rendering timestamps in server-local time, so customers in Kestrel Bay saw shifted day boundaries. Fix stores everything UTC and converts at render using the workspace timezone, falling back to the org default. Edge case: scheduled exports that straddle a DST change now pin to the first occurrence. Tests cover the fallback chain but not legacy CSVs — flag anything suspicious there. The export service now runs with these settings.

deployment values, yadug-bawif:
[framir]
team = pelox
access_code = ac_a38ab2
owner = tamion.julael
host = framir.tolvaqlabs.test
port = 11211
peer = tammir.zemvargrid.local
salt = 2215ef03
pin = 1541

## Env Vars — Payroll Export v3

As of this sprint, Ledgerhorn exports payroll in the new column-delimited v3 format. The old XML exporter is removed. Set PAYX_FORMAT=v3 in staging before Thursday's cutover; Marisol owns the rollback plan. The export worker also signs each batch now, so it needs the signing secret in its env file:

sealed setting: RELAY_SECRET13=bca49b02a6971

**Q: Why did the snapshot suite block my release?**

A: Velmora snapshots fail closed — any pixel drift in a tagged component halts the train. Usually it's a font rendering change, not a real bug. Review the diffs in the gallery; approve or reject each one. Bulk-approving requires elevating to the release keyring, so enter the recovery passphrase below.

vault phrase of taweg-kafof = oliax-zorael